From 06986222c926b5f7a7b5b4536cd8ccaadc3b66a7 Mon Sep 17 00:00:00 2001 From: Matthew Waters Date: Sat, 14 May 2016 16:27:26 +0300 Subject: [PATCH] gl: take the affine transformation in NDC Provide a function to get the affine matrix in the meta in terms of NDC coordinates and use as a standard opengl matrix.
